عنوان مقاله :
مطالعه و آناليز فازي پودر نانوكامپوزيت Cu-Al2O3 ساخته شده با روش ترموشيميايي

چكيده لاتين :
At the present paper producing of Cu-3wt % A1203 and Cu-5wt % A1203 nanocomposite powder with thermochemical method was studied. The produced phases at different stages of heat treatments were characterized by differential thermal and thermogravimetric analysis (DTA-TGA), X-ray diffraction (XRD), scanning electron microscopy (SEM) and transmission electron microscopy (TEM). Nanocomposite powders were produced through the following stages: Preparing aquos solutions of copper nitrate and aluminum nitrate to achieving the final composition, heating water solution and making precursor powder, the salt-removing heat treatment, the heat treatments at different temperatures for the formation of alumina and the reduction of CuO into Cu at different temperatures in the H2 atmosphere. Optimum temperature for the formation of alumina and reduction of powders was obtained at 850°C and 820°C, respectively. The size of alumina particles produced by thermochemical method was about 20-50 nm.
